Jaye Johnson
Not good enough technical qualities for skiing

So - I would say this is not really a ‘ski’ brand, it’s a fashion brand. It’s not good enough, technically. I do like their knitwear though, so it gets a 2 instead of a 1 star. But ski stuff, just not good enough.I bought the faux leather salopettes - the ribbed knee support is too low and it’s a real pain in the ass. It’s uncomfortable and you have to keep hitching it up. I saw someone in the faux white leather and she said exactly the same thing about the ribbed knee supports. Goldbergh do a ribbed knee ski trouser but it’s less rigid and there’s no issue with it. It’s too long I’m 5.5 bought a M1 10/12. I’d say it was a neat 10. They are very very flared at the bottoms which is a bit odd. I hired some stuff too - no ski pass pockets in the arm on the vast majority of their coats which is a huge pain at the lifts.If you are a proper skier I would not by Perfect Moment, it’s all wrong. If you just want ski fashion, it’s great.

Aysha Taylor
Expensive product, poor quality

Maya Parka coat is warm and stylish but the quality is poor. After just 1 season (worn for about 2 weeks) the cuffs are very worn and the material in places had pulled. Not what you'd expect from an almost £800 product. If you actually intend to ski (I'm a very average skier) then this is not the product for you.
